Once the socket is connected, it can send and receive data from the server … WebFeb 25, 2024 · This is the simplest technique for creating a concurrent server. Whenever a new client connects to the server, a fork () call is executed making a new child process for each new client. Multi-Threading achieves a concurrent server using a single processed program. Sharing of data/files with connections is usually slower with a fork () than with ...

WebDec 28, 2016 · A streaming protocol has no concept of a message. recv may receive any amount of data, which leads to two unpleasant scenarios:. a terminating byte is not (yet) received. printf prints whatever garbage is in the buffer (maybe leftovers from previous receives, maybe uninitialized data). WebApr 16, 2024 · That means a single client cannot open more than 65535 simultaneous connections to a single server. But a server can (theoretically) serve 65535 simultaneous connections per client. So in practice the server is only limited by how much CPU power, memory etc. it has to serve requests, not by the number of TCP connections to the server. WebMar 31, 2015 · 6. Rather than blocking on accept (), you use select () to tell you when a client is pending so you can then call accept () without blocking. Then you can monitor the TCP and UDP sockets at the same time.
